Output bec70783ad09df7ee82438418f66d20887e5778fe560da229fd766c3585974fc:0

value
34000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c823abab64243cd16efcf4e27852a3b6d304414b OP_EQUAL
address
3KwFoLzPSNcwYXHCU8s7ZbK4ai64nfQj8N
transaction
bec70783ad09df7ee82438418f66d20887e5778fe560da229fd766c3585974fc